
About this episode
As PHP and Laravel programmers, we use Composer every day. But we often don't know its history, nuances, or the plans for the future.
In this episode Matt talks with Jordi Bogianno, co-creator and co-maintainer of Composer, about the powerful tool's history, common use cases, and overall purpose. But we also dive into some nuances, some common mistakes, how it differs from NPM, and the future of the tool.
